Enhancing Data Accuracy with OCR Software

In the fast-paced world of logistics, accuracy is key to ensuring smooth operations. One way companies are enhancing data accuracy is through the implementation of OCR software.

OCR technology enables the automatic extraction and processing of data from various documents such as invoices, bills of lading, and manifests. This eliminates manual entry errors and reduces the risk of inaccuracies in critical information.

By digitizing and analyzing text from scanned documents, OCR software not only improves accuracy but also speeds up processes that would otherwise be time-consuming for human workers. This results in more efficient workflows and better decision-making based on reliable data.

With OCR software in place, logistics companies can minimize costly mistakes, streamline their operations, and provide customers with a higher level of service. The future looks bright for those embracing this innovative technology to drive success in an increasingly competitive industry.

Challenges and Solutions in Implementing OCR Technology

Implementing OCR technology in logistics comes with its own set of challenges. One common issue is the compatibility of OCR software with existing systems. It can be daunting to integrate new technology seamlessly without disrupting current operations.

Another challenge is ensuring the accuracy and reliability of OCR results, especially when dealing with large volumes of data. Any errors or discrepancies can lead to delays and inefficiencies in logistics processes.

Moreover, training staff to effectively use OCR software and interpret the data it provides is crucial for successful implementation. Resistance to change and lack of proper training can hinder adoption rates and overall effectiveness.

Fortunately, there are solutions available to address these challenges. Working closely with IT professionals and providers during the implementation phase can help overcome compatibility issues. Regular system updates and maintenance can ensure smooth operation over time.

Investing in comprehensive training programs for employees and implementing quality control measures can enhance accuracy levels while reducing errors caused by human factors. By addressing these challenges proactively, companies can fully leverage the benefits that OCR technology offers in streamlining logistics operations.
